Black Heritage in Canada (True North)  

Black Canadians have played an influential role in Canadian history and continue to do so today. Black Heritage in Canada explores the challenges Black Canadian’s have faced while showcasing the contributions and achievements they have made in arts and entertainment, sports, politics, and in the World Wars. Through this series students will see how the past actions of Black Canadians have helped to shape present outcomes.

Black History in Canada (Coast 2 Coast 2 Coast)  

Black Canadians have shaped Canadian history since it was first colonized. Black History in Canada explores the struggles many early black settlers faced and how black Canadians have fought throughout history for equal treatment. Readers will learn about the important contributions black Canadians have made from their initial arrival in colonial times through the present day.

Canada Turns 150  

Journey through 150 years of Canadian history in this celebratory series. Canada Turns 150 highlights important people and events that helped shape the nation between 1867 and 2017. Readers will explore key moments in politics, social issues, sports, arts, conflicts, and more.
